I've mailed two packages overseas in the past three weeks, and the US postal service no longer offers the "slow boat" method of shipping. Everything is sent via air. Anyone that is shopping for someone overseas will have to pay careful attention to the weight of the package or it could get quite pricey.Originally Posted by halfpint

For those in the US, the dollar section at Target is a great place for stocking stuffers. They have loads of notepads, pens, pencils, refrigerator magnets, etc. I get a bunch of this stuff and fill up a stocking with it. (My granddaughters get coloring books, crayons and ponytail holders, from that section). Target usually has a good selection of kitty-themed socks, too.
Big Lots has name-brand kitty toys and treats, as well as candles, cookies, candles, cat calenders and bath stuff.
You can fill up a nice box, without busting the budget.
